The Nintendo Switch version is part of the Batman: Arkham Trilogy collection. Unlike previous entries, Arkham Knight is a massive, technically demanding title that pushes the Switch hardware to its absolute limits. To play the game, you need a significant amount of storage space and a stable connection for initial updates. Technical Performance and Expectations Bringing a high-fidelity PlayStation 4 and Xbox One era game to the Switch required significant optimization. Here is what you can expect from the gameplay: Resolution: Dynamic resolution is used to maintain performance during intense Batmobile sequences. Graphics: Some textures and lighting effects have been scaled back compared to the PC version. Portability: The biggest draw is playing the full Arkham Knight experience in handheld mode. Content: The Switch version includes all previously released DLC, such as story expansions and character skins. Understanding the Arkham Knight File When looking for the Batman: Arkham Knight Switch files, players often encounter different formats. The NSP (Nintendo Submission Package) is the standard format used for digital titles on the Switch. Because Arkham Knight is part of a trilogy pack, the file size is substantial. Even if you purchase the physical cartridge, a massive digital download is required to play Arkham Knight, as the full game cannot fit on a standard Switch game card. This makes a high-speed microSD card an absolute necessity for any Batman fan. Batman Arkham Knight: A Brief Overview Developed by Rocksteady Studios and published by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ment, Batman Arkham Knight is an action-adventure game that was initially released in 2015 for PC, PlayStation 4, and Xbox One. The game takes place in an open-world Gotham City, where Batman faces off against his most iconic foes, including the Joker, Harley Quinn, and the Riddler. The game features a variety of gameplay mechanics, including combat, stealth, and exploration. The combat system, known as the "FreeFlow" system, allows players to seamlessly transition between taking down multiple enemies, using a combination of martial arts and gadgets. The game also features a large open world to explore, complete with side missions, collectibles, and secrets.
